Nalbandian: no one but Karabakhi people to decide their land's fate

PanARMENIAN.Net - Armenia hopes that the June 6 presidential meeting will produce effect, RA Foreign Minister said.



"Armenia is willing to continue talks on the basis of Madrid proposals the OSCE MG Co-chairs handed to the Ministers of Foreign Affairs of Armenia and Azerbaijan. The sides do not intend to develop new proposals. However, Azerbaijan should also be ready to continue talks," Edward Nalbandian told a news conference in Yerevan.



"The Nagorno Karabakh conflict settlement process is very complicated and I would not like international organizations or persons concerned to interfere. No one but Karabakhi people will decide the fate of their land.
